Grasping Backflow Prevention Systems

Backflow prevention systems play a vital role in protecting our water supply from contamination. These systems prevent the backward flow of contaminated water into clean water lines, which can pose serious health risks.

Several types of backflow prevention assemblies, each designed for specific applications. Some common types encompass pressure vacuum breakers, double check valves, and atmospheric vacuum breakers.

Understanding the mechanism of these systems is key for ensuring the safety and cleanliness of our drinking water. Regular inspection and maintenance are vital to keep backflow prevention systems functioning effectively.

Preventing Backflow : A Crucial Element in Plumbing

Backflow prevention is vital to maintaining clean water systems. It involves stopping the reverse flow of polluted water back into the potable supply. Without proper backflow prevention measures can lead to a variety of problems, such as health hazards and damage to equipment.

Backflow can occur when there is a variation in pressure between the potable water supply and the dirty water system. This can happen during repairs, or if there are faulty valves or pipes.

To prevent backflow, it is necessary to install backflow preventers that act as a blockage between the two systems. These devices are designed to open water flow in one direction only, and immediately shut off when the flow flows opposite.

Ensuring Compliance with Backflow Prevention Measures

Implementing rigorous backflow prevention measures is crucial for safeguarding public health and stopping contamination of the water supply. Diverse regulations and codes govern these practices, prescribing specific standards for installation, inspection, and maintenance of backflow prevention devices. These regulations vary by jurisdiction, so it's critical for property owners and businesses to consult the applicable regional requirements. Failure to comply with said regulations can result in serious consequences, such as fines, penalties, and even termination of water service.

Furthermore, maintaining compliance involves a combination of routine maintenance by qualified professionals and comprehensive learning for personnel responsible for handling backflow prevention devices. By observing these regulations, individuals and organizations can contribute to secure water supply for everyone.
